Linux 中经常见到的 gz 文件的解压和压缩文

嗨,让我告诉你有关 Linux 中这些 gz 文件的信息。

当我上次在 2 02 3 年做一个项目时,经常会看到这些文件。
事实上,这些.gz文件是使用gzip压缩算法创建的压缩包。

有几种方法可以压缩这些 gz 文件:
1 直接用gzip命令压缩:假设你有一个test.txt.gz;您在终端中输入 gzip -d test.txt.gz 或 gzip -dk test.txt.gz 。
输入此命令后,test.txt将被压缩,但原始文件test.txt.gz将直接用gzip解压。
我以前经历过这个。
上次我不小心滑倒,丢失了重要文件。
我很担心。
2 、使用gunzip命令进行压缩:这个命令实际上和gzip -d的意思是一样的,专门用来压缩一个文件。
例如,gunzip test.txt.gz 压缩 test.txt 并删除原始 .gz 文件。
该命令的名称较短,以便于记住。
3 . 压缩归档文件,如 tar.gz:如果您有一个使用 tar 压缩文件的软件包,如 test.tar.gz。
使用 tar -xzvf test.tar.gz -C /path/to/destination。
-x是解压,-z是gzip格式,-v是显示过程(看起来很酷); -f 后接文件名; -C 指定解压到哪个目录。
上次我毁掉了一个很大的包裹。
没有 -v 我看不到进度,这有点令人困惑。
经常使用这个命令,你就会习惯它。

压缩文件;主要使用gzip命令:
如果直接输入gzip文件名。
默认情况下,文件名将被压缩为 filename.gz。
然后将使用 gzip 提取原始文件名。
如果要保留原始文件,请在gzip -k filename等命令后添加-k。
这样就会生成filename.gz;但是,文件名仍然存在。
我经常用这个。
有时你想看看压缩后原始文件是否发生了变化。
例如,如果要压缩多个文件,如果您有一个临时目录和两个txt文件file1 .txt和file2 .txt,并且想要将它们解压缩到一个myarchive.tar.gz中。
可以先 tar -cvf myarchive.tar temp file1 .txt file2 .txt 将其解压到 myarchive.tar 中;使用更高的 gzip。
步骤 9 (myarch) 指定值。
压缩率越高,所需时间越长。
)将它们压缩为myarchive.tar.gz。
这种打包和压缩使管理变得更加容易。
想了解更多吗?
很简单;只需直接在终端中输入 man gzip 或 man tar 即可。
Linux man手册非常详细,包括参数选项和使用示例。
刚开始学习的时候,很多限制我都不记得了,但是只要看人就慢慢习惯了。

总的来说,在 Linux 上使用 gz 文件非常直观。
有适用于缩小和压缩的命令和限制。
打字的时候很多你将会变得熟练。
但是,在使用 gzip 压缩提取原始文件之前,不要忘记进行确认。
别像我以前那样着急。
无论如何,这取决于你。

Linux 中经常见到的 gz 文件的解压和压缩文

哦,是的,Linux上的gz文件主要是通过gzip命令来压缩和压缩的。
我会告诉你具体如何做。

解压gz文件: 一种方法是使用 gzip 命令并直接键入 gzip,文件名如 gzipdfilename.gz。
然后它会被压缩到当前目录,原来的gz文件就会消失。
k参数如果想保留原文件,gzipdkfilename.gz不会被删除。

另一种方法是gunzip命令,它是gzipd的缩写版本。
gunzipfilename.gz 还压缩单个 gz 文件。
原始文件也将被删除。
如果你想保留它,你必须自己复制它。

解压缩 tar.gz 文件。
这有点复杂。
这是一个类似 tar.gz 的存档文件。
如果要压缩,请使用tarxzvffilename.tar.gz;这会将其压缩到当前目录。
如果要转到其他目录,请在末尾添加 -t,然后导航到目标目录。

压缩文件为gz格式: 比较简单; gzip 命令 使用 gzip 文件名;直接压缩,原来的文件已经不存在了。
如果要保存原始文件,需要压缩后手动复制。
或者,您可以考虑使用其他工具使用 gzip 进行压缩。

将多个文件压缩为 tar.gz 格式: 这可以分两步完成。
首先,要将多个文件打包到一个 tar 文件中,请使用 tarcvfarchive.tarfilename1 filename2 ... 然后 gziparchive.tar 将 tar 文件压缩为 tar.gz 文件使用或者,可以使用更简单直接的 tarczvfarchive.tar.gzfilename1 filename2 ... 这一步就完成了压缩包的加载和压缩。

需要更多帮助: mangzip 在终端中查看 gzip 和 tar 命令的详细说明以及如何使用它们;键入 mantar 或相关帮助命令。

好吧,这是可能的。